The broader clean-energy equity space continues to face headwinds, with sustained selling pressure evident in benchmarks such as the Invesco Solar ETF (TAN) and iShares Global Clean Energy ETF (ICLN) since mid-April. This rotation away from growth-oriented and environmentally focused names toward defensive and energy value plays may continue to weigh on Energy Recovery (ERII), given its correlation to water and energy efficiency subsectors that remain out of favor under current interest rate expectations.

Technically, ERII has slipped below both its 50- and 200-day moving averages, a pattern that often signals deteriorating momentum. The stock is testing critical support near $8.96, a level market participants view as a potential inflection point. Above-average volume accompanying the decline suggests conviction among sellers, making a near-term reversal more difficult even as relative strength indicators enter oversold territory. Analysts estimate that oversold conditions may persist or deepen before stabilization occurs, particularly without a positive catalyst.

Sector rotation away from high-beta industrials and speculative technology stocks remains a dominant theme. A decisive reclaim of the $9.90 resistance on above-average volume could signal renewed buyer interest, but no immediate catalyst is evident. Until such a move materializes, ERII’s trajectory is likely to remain tethered to macro-driven sentiment and the broader appetite for clean-energy exposure. Volatility may stay elevated, demanding close monitoring of key support and resistance levels.
